The data and analysis on this page pertains to Lakeland-Winter Haven, FL,
hereinafter referred to as "Lakeland". The all time high in the Lakeland Home
Price Index was 251.8 in the 2nd Quarter, of 2007. The 4th Quarter, 2012 index
value was 141.8. That's a decline of 109.97 points or 43.68% below the
Lakeland Home Price Index all time high.  The Home Price Index indicates that
the Lakeland Market is up 2% over the last 10 years. Home Prices in the
Lakeland Real Estate Market have lost 1.01% over the last 12 months.

The 4th Quarter index value was 0.69 points higher than the 3rd Quarter, 2012
index value of 141.12, resulting in a 0.49% rise in the 4th Quarter for the
Lakeland Market.

The Lakeland Home Price Index has increased for the last 3 consecutive
quarters. The current record holder for consecutive increases in the Home
Price Index is Bismarck, ND, with increases in the last 11 consecutive quarters.
The current record holder for consecutive declines in the Home Price Index is
Tallahassee, FL, with declines in the last 5 consecutive quarters.

The highest annual home appreciation rate in the Lakeland Real Estate Market
was 34% in the twelve months ended with the 1st Quarter of 2006. The worst
annual home appreciation rate in the Lakeland Market was -19% in the twelve
months ended with the 1st Quarter of 2010.

The highest home appreciation in the Lakeland Real Estate Market over a three
year period was 69% in the three years ended with the 3rd Quarter of 2006.
The worst home appreciation over a three year period in the Lakeland Market
was -39% in the three years ended with the 1st Quarter of 2011.

Historical data on the Lakeland Home Price Index is available back to the 2nd
Quarter, of 1985. All calculations are based on the quarterly value of the House
Price Index for the Lakeland Market. The terms House Price Index and Home
Price Index, as used in this site, refer to the Federal Housing Finance Agency
(FHFA) House Price Index.

Part 4: APPRECIATION RATES & RANKINGS
4th Quarter, 2012 Housing Data: Lakeland, Florida

The appreciation of Lakeland Home Prices relative to 380 other metropolitan
areas is detailed below. Each metropolitan area contains one or more cities.
Five different time periods are reviewed.  Each paragraph identifies the top and
bottom performing markets as well as the average and median performance for
all cities during each time period. The data and analysis on this page pertains
to Lakeland-Winter Haven, FL, hereinafter referred to as "Lakeland".

Last Quarter:
During the 4th Quarter of 2012, Lakeland Home Prices had a rank of 188, with
appreciation of 0.49%. The top performing real estate market during the 4th
Quarter was Bismarck, ND, with appreciation of 4.55%. The worst market during
that period was Hattiesburg, MS, with appreciation of -4.02%.
The median appreciation for all cities during the 4th Quarter was 0.47%. The
average appreciation for all markets during the quarter was 0.54%.

Last Year:
During the last 12 months, Lakeland Home Prices had a rank of 266, with
appreciation during the year of -1.01%. The top performing market during the
last year was Bismarck, ND, with appreciation of 13.4%. The worst real estate
market during that period was Gainesville, FL, with appreciation of -6.8%.
The median appreciation for all markets during this period was 0.27%. The
average appreciation was 0.31%.

Last 5 Years:
Over the 5 years ended with the 4th Quarter of 2012, Lakeland Home Prices
ranked 368, with a total appreciation of -41.6%. The top performing real estate
market during the 5 year period was Bismarck, ND, with appreciation of 24%.
The worst market during that period was Las Vegas, NV, with appreciation of
-54%.
The median appreciation for all cities during this time period was -9%. The
average appreciation over the 5 years was -12%.

Last 10 Years:
During the 10 years ended in the 4th Quarter of 2012, Lakeland Home Prices
had a rank of 317, with appreciation during the decade of 2%. The top
performing market during the period was Midland, TX, with appreciation of
104%. The worst real estate market during the 10 year time period was Detroit,
MI, with appreciation of -31%.
The median appreciation for all markets during the last 10 years was 18%. The
average appreciation for the cities over that time frame was 18%.

Last 20 Years:
During the 20 years ended in the 4th Quarter of 2012, Lakeland Home Prices
had a rank of 338, with total appreciation over the 20 year period of 44%. The
top performing real estate market during the period was Casper, WY, with
appreciation of 210%. The worst market during the last 20 years was Las
Vegas, NV, with appreciation of 7%.
The median appreciation for all cities during the last 20 years was 78%. The
average appreciation for the markets over that time frame was 80%.

Historical research data on the Home Price Index for the Lakeland Real Estate
Market is available back to the 2nd Quarter, of 1985. All calculations are based
on the quarterly value of the House Price Index for Lakeland. Real estate
appreciation figures represent total appreciation over each time period. (Unless
specifically stated, the appreciation figures do not represent annual or quarterly
rates of appreciation.)
